Qualifications Education and Experience
High school diploma/GED.
Seven (7) years of mechanical experience in gas/diesel engines, heavy equipment service and repair, hydraulic/air brakes, electrical/electronic systems, and HVAC.
Must possess a valid state driver's license and obtain a valid Florida CDL A driver's license within six (6) months of hire or promotion.
If assigned to Fire Apparatus: EVT certification.
If assigned to School Buses: School Bus Safety Inspector Certification within six (6) months of hire or promotion.
Key Responsibilities
Performs highly skilled and specialized maintenance and repair work on City automotive and mechanical equipment.
Provides service to a variety of complex vehicles, apparatus, machinery, motors, and related equipment.
Modifies, fabricates, and alters original vehicles, equipment, and apparatus configuration for specialized use by department.
Performs various record maintenance duties, i.e., work descriptions, parts, and supplies per work order.
Log work and materials in fleet computer system.
